Bendigo Bank Impersonation Reports for 04 3048 6631
A contributor has reported receiving an SMS from 04 3048 6631 (also written as 0430486631) impersonating Bendigo Bank security. The message claimed the recipient's account had suspicious activity and requested immediate action via a provided landline number. The contributor identified this as a known scam tactic designed to harvest banking credentials or personal information.
This Vodafone-provisioned mobile number uses a classic impersonation approach: creating false urgency around account security to pressure victims into calling a fake support line controlled by the scammer.
What the SMS from 04 3048 6631 Claims
The message falsely attributed to Bendigo Bank security alleged account snooping or unauthorised access. The SMS included a landline number presented as official support, a common tactic to redirect victims away from legitimate Bendigo Bank contact channels and into direct communication with scammers who can manipulate the conversation in real time.
This approach exploits trust in banking institutions. Most Australians recognise Bendigo Bank as a legitimate financial service, making an SMS warning about account compromise feel credible. The inclusion of a specific callback number adds false legitimacy and creates the impression of an official security response.

What to Do If You Receive an SMS from 04 3048 6631
If 0430486631 or a similar number sends you an SMS claiming to be from Bendigo Bank:
- Do not: Call the number provided in the message, reply to the SMS, or click any links
- Do not: Share your account details, password, PIN, or security codes with anyone who contacts you
- Do: Delete the message immediately
- Do: Contact Bendigo Bank directly using the phone number on your bank statements or their official website
- Do: Report the SMS as spam and block the number 04 3048 6631 on your phone
- Do: Forward the message to the ACMA's report spam service at 0429 999 888 and include the full sender details
How to Report 04 3048 6631
Report this number and scam SMS to Australian authorities:
- ACMA (Australian Communications and Media Authority): Forward the spam SMS to 0429 999 888 with the sender number and full message text. ACMA investigates telecommunications offences including impersonation scams.
- Scamwatch: Report the scam at scamwatch.gov.au with a description of the message, the callback number, and any actions you took. Scamwatch collates community reports to identify emerging scam trends.
- Bendigo Bank directly: Contact your bank's fraud team through official channels on the back of your bank card or at their official website to report the impersonation attempt.

Protecting Yourself from Banking Impersonation Scams
Banks never ask you to verify account details, passwords, or security codes via SMS or phone calls you initiate from their message. If you receive an unexpected security alert from 04 3048 6631 or any number, always verify by calling your bank directly using the contact number on your statements or official website-never use a number provided in the suspicious message.
Scammers impersonating Bendigo Bank often exploit customers' trust in the institution and their instinct to act quickly when account security seems compromised. Taking a moment to verify through official channels prevents credential theft and financial fraud.

Is 04 3048 6631 actually Bendigo Bank?
No. 04 3048 6631 (0430486631) is a Vodafone mobile number impersonating Bendigo Bank. Bendigo Bank does not send security alerts via SMS requesting you to call a number provided in the message. Always verify banking alerts by contacting your bank directly using the number on your card or official website.
What should I do if I called the number in the SMS from 04 3048 6631?
If you called the landline provided by 0430486631 and shared any personal information, contact Bendigo Bank immediately on their official support number to report potential fraud. Monitor your account for unusual activity and consider changing your online banking password. Report the scam to Scamwatch at scamwatch.gov.au.
How can I block 04 3048 6631 on my phone?
On most Australian phones, open the message from 04 3048 6631, tap the sender number or 'more' options, and select 'Block' or 'Report as Spam'. You can also go to your phone's settings and add 0430486631 to a blocked contacts list. After blocking, forward the original SMS to 0429 999 888 to report it to the ACMA.
Why did I receive an SMS from 0430486631 when I don't use Bendigo Bank?
Scammers using 04 3048 6631 send impersonation SMS to random numbers in bulk hoping some recipients will panic and respond. They don't verify who actually banks with Bendigo-the goal is to catch anyone worried about account security. Even if you don't bank with them, report the SMS to 0429 999 888.
Can I report 04 3048 6631 to Vodafone?
Yes. Contact Vodafone directly and report that their customer on number 0430486631 is being used for impersonation scams. Vodafone can suspend or investigate the account. You can also report the number to the ACMA at 0429 999 888, which has authority to take action against telcos misusing their services.
What happens if I click a link in an SMS from 04 3048 6631?
Clicking a link in an SMS from 0430486631 may download malware, redirect you to a fake banking website to steal credentials, or sign you up for premium services. If you accidentally clicked a link, do not enter any information. Close the page, delete the SMS, report it to 0429 999 888, and monitor your phone and accounts for suspicious activity.
